About Experimental Ai

Experimental AI refers to cutting-edge research and development in artificial intelligence, exploring novel algorithms, models, and applications. These tools push the boundaries of current AI capabilities, often tackling unsolved problems or integrating AI with emerging technologies. As a forward-looking segment within Technology, they offer a glimpse into the future of AI, driving innovation across various domains.

Developing Novel Drug Discovery Models

Pharmaceutical researchers use experimental AI to explore new molecular structures and predict drug efficacy. By applying cutting-edge algorithms to vast chemical databases, they can identify potential drug candidates faster and more efficiently than traditional methods, accelerating early-stage drug development and reducing research costs.

Generating Synthetic Data for Rare Events

Data scientists employ experimental generative AI to create realistic synthetic datasets for rare or sensitive events. This is crucial in fields like medical research or fraud detection where real data is scarce or privacy-protected. The synthetic data helps train robust AI models without compromising confidentiality or requiring extensive real-world data collection.

Advancing Explainable AI (XAI) Techniques

AI ethicists and developers utilize experimental AI tools to build more transparent and interpretable AI models. This involves developing new methods to visualize and understand how complex AI systems make decisions, enhancing trust and accountability. XAI is crucial for applications in sensitive areas like finance, healthcare, and legal systems, where understanding AI's reasoning is paramount.
